OGIO unveils ‘Day of the Dead’ designs

OGIO has released a new golf travel cover in an exciting, colourful design – featuring bright orange and red hues with a ‘Day of the Dead’ twist – as part of a new line of products. 

The ‘Sugar Skulls’ range takes inspiration from the Mexican festival – a two-day celebration held in the first week of November in remembrance of friends and family who have passed away – and sees three popular, existing products brought to life.

Golfers looking to head off on their travels can enjoy the new design as the Sugar Skulls Alpha Travel Cover hits the market.

Priced at £140, OGIO’s smallest travel cover remains generously sized to fit both cart and stand bags and comes with extra room to fit items such as shoes, golf balls and clothes.

The Alpha Travel Cover has been released after OGIO debuted its most eclectic range of golf travel covers earlier this year with inventive designs including Whiskey, Terra Texture, Digi Camo and Warp Speed.
